How to get from Accrington to Warrington by bus and train?

By bus and train

To get from Accrington to Warrington in North West, you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one bus line: take the NORTHERN train from Accrington station to Manchester Victoria station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the TRANSPENNINE EXPRESS train and finally take the 22A bus from Newton-Le-Willows Rail Station (Stop B) station to Central Station station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 7 min.

Alternative route by bus and train via X41 and TRANSPENNINE EXPRESS

To get from Accrington to Warrington in North West, take the X41 bus from Accrington station to Chorlton Street Coach Station (Stop Ez) station. Next, take the TRANSPENNINE EXPRESS train from Manchester Piccadilly station to Warrington Central station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 21 min.
